Expose ModemActivitiyInfo to system API
ModemActivityInfo is used for batteryStatusService which is part of
system service. To prepare telephony to be an mainline module, we
should expose ModemActivityInfo to systemAPI
1. remove getConsumedPower API as we are missing modem support, API
today only report 0
2. isValid API is introduced to cover modem issues before. Do not
expose this for now.
